The Protective Properties of PPF


PPF is crafted from a strong urethane material engineered to act like an invisible shield over your vehicle's paint. Unlike wax or sealants that sit atop the surface, PPF forms a durable barrier that absorbs impact from road debris, including stones, salt crystals, and ice particles thrown up during winter drives, stopping the chips and scratches that would otherwise expose paint to corrosion.


Industry testing and manufacturer data suggest that high-quality PPF can maintain near-factory gloss levels for 5 years or more under proper maintenance and moderate environmental exposure. PPF also plays a key role in chemical protection: road salt, applied liberally during winter, accelerates oxidation and rust if left unchecked, but the hydrophobic nature of modern PPF reduces salt adhesion by about 50%, meaning less corrosive residue clings to your car over time and washing becomes easier.


Self Healing Capabilities


One notable feature of advanced car PPF is its self healing topcoat. Minor scratches and swirl marks caused by ice scrapers or gritty snow can smooth out on their own when exposed to warmth, whether from sunlight or a warm cloth. This action is temperature dependent and works best above roughly 60°F (15.5°C); below freezing the effect slows considerably, so regular cleaning, pH neutral products, and periodic checks for lifting edges remain essential through the season.


Winter Hazards: Snow, Ice, and Road Salt


Winter driving introduces a harsh environment where snow, ice, and road salt converge, testing both PPF and the paintwork it guards.


Road Salt


Road salt, predominantly sodium chloride, combines with moisture to form corrosive brine that accelerates oxidation, leading to rust on metal parts and undermining PPF adhesives. A northern city may apply up to 300,000 tons of road salt across its streets in a single winter season, and continuous exposure can degrade PPF adhesives by as much as 30% over six months. The best defense is regular washing with pH neutral cleaners to prevent salt buildup at film edges and wheel wells.


Ice and Snow Buildup


Heavy snow and ice can adhere stubbornly around wheel arches and lower panels, and improper shifting or scraping risks scratching or chipping paint where no protective barrier exists. Modern PPF remains flexible even at temperatures down to negative 10°C, resisting cracking under contraction, and self healing properties activate with mild heat from sun or engine warmth. Repeated freeze thaw cycles can still cause microscopic cracking, reducing protective performance by roughly 12%, though consistent upkeep minimizes this. Use gentle melting methods, such as de icer sprays or warming the engine, rather than harsh scraping or abrasive tools.

PPF Durability in Cold Weather


Today's premium PPFs use high grade polyurethane that stretches and conforms to complex curves without becoming brittle even at temperatures as low as negative 40°F, and owners in northern climates regularly report no visible damage or loss of adhesion through harsh winter storms.


Professional installation is essential for best results, since expert installers tailor humidity control and surface preparation to lower temperatures, helping prevent bubbles or edge lifting. PPF also shields against cumulative damage from salty roads and ice laden gravel; its multi layer polymer structure blocks chemicals from reaching the vehicle's surface, while hydrophobic topcoats repel water and reduce moisture buildup beneath edges and seams. Impact of Road Salt on PPF


Road salt becomes aggressive once combined with moisture, forming corrosive brine that settles in hidden crevices like wheel wells, bumpers, and rocker panels. A properly applied PPF seals off these vulnerable areas, preventing salt and other contaminants from reaching the paint beneath. Studies comparing vehicles with PPF versus untreated counterparts show up to a 70% reduction in corrosion related damage after winter exposure, though this protection depends on good maintenance, including regular washing with pH neutral shampoos. Practical tips for the salty winter months include the following.


  • Wash often: remove salt deposits promptly using gentle, pH balanced products.
  • Avoid automatic brushes: these can cause microscopic scratches that weaken self healing properties.
  • Focus on edges: salt intrusion often occurs along film edges, so inspect and clean these carefully.
  • Apply ceramic coatings: layering ceramic coating atop PPF enhances chemical resistance and durability.
  • Use quick detailers: keep waterless wash sprays handy for quick contaminant removal between full washes.

Maintenance Tips During Winter


Regular cleaning is critical because salt and grime accumulate quickly. Washing your car every one to two weeks helps prevent corrosive salt crystals from embedding into film edges. Use a pH neutral detergent, since harsh chemicals can degrade the film's adhesive or clarity, and always dry your vehicle thoroughly with a soft microfiber towel rather than air drying, which helps avoid water spots and mineral deposits.


Frequent inspection is also essential, since freezing temperatures combined with road salt can cause small edges of the film to lift or peel unnoticed, particularly around wheel arches, lower doors, and bumpers. Think of winter PPF care as a three step cycle: wash carefully and regularly, dry meticulously with soft fabrics, and inspect often for signs of wear.


Choosing the Right PPF for Winter


Not all PPFs respond the same way to snow, salt, and frigid temperatures, so choose a product designed to endure these challenges. Durability should be a top priority: look for a PPF that maintains adhesion and flexibility well below freezing, since ordinary films may stiffen or peel under such stress. Self healing properties allow the film to mend minor scratches with heat exposure, and UV protection matters too, since intense UV rays reflecting off snow can accelerate discoloration even in winter.

Common Winter Myths about PPF


One persistent myth suggests that PPF will crack or peel in freezing temperatures. Modern PPFs, such as those applied by professionals at JL’s Showroom Auto Salon, are engineered for extreme conditions and maintain flexibility and adhesive strength even below negative 20°C (about negative 4°F), with material testing showing over 90% adhesion remaining intact in cold weather.


Another misunderstanding is that road salt rapidly deteriorates PPF surfaces. While road salt is corrosive when left on paint, high quality polyurethane films resist salt damage effectively, and self healing topcoats help repel salt crystals from embedding into the paintwork. Routine washing remains crucial, however, since removing salt deposits within about 48 hours stops chemical etching and prolongs film life.

How Window Tint Affects Visibility When you apply tint to your car windows, you are adding a filter that reduces visible light passing through the glass. The lower the Visible Light Transmission (VLT) percentage, the darker the tint and the less light reaches your eyes. A 5% VLT tint, for example, lets through just 5% of daylight, which can seriously hamper your ability to notice hazards on poorly lit roads. Studies suggest that windows tinted at 20% VLT reduce night visibility by about 25% compared to untinted glass, shrinking sight distances from roughly 500 feet to around 350 to 375 feet. Not all tints impact visibility equally, however. Ceramic tints have gained popularity because they offer excellent heat rejection and UV protection while maintaining higher clarity. A ceramic tint at 35% VLT often strikes the best balance: effective glare reduction during daylight with minimal sacrifice in nighttime visibility. Tinting also varies by placement; front side windows carry the strictest legal limits in most states because they affect driver visibility most directly, while rear windows can typically accommodate darker films.
